Ritalin is an indie band from Dublin/Wicklow that I have written about previously, and most importantly, I expressed my deep admiration for their wonderful song, Anymore. You can read that amazing piece of work here.
On September 1st, 2025, Ritalin will release their debut EP, Growing Pains, on all major streaming platforms. What really impresses me is, this is a DIY project and you'd be hard pressed to tell, such is the fantastic production and well mixed and mastered output. The band retain their impressive vocal harmonies from their earlier releases but have added a more polished production quality with a brilliantly multi tracked and layered sound. This is very evident on the title track which builds momentum and has a wonderful atmospheric outro. The title song also has a great guitar solo with an awesome tone. I just wish the solo was a little longer as I was about to get my Pink Floyd head nod going. The whole EP even has a concept album feel, which I won't spoil. Go listen.
In the words of Ritalin themselves,
"This EP is about the messy process of growing, in many aspects of the word – and the pains, obstacles and experiences that come with that.”

Stand out tracks for me are, There 4 Me, Holding On To You, Cloud 9 and the title track, Growing Pains. Ok, I get it! I've just named them all but they're all a little different and great in their own way. If you put a gun to my head, right now, I'd say the absolute best track on the album is the closing one, There 4 Me. It's a total indie classic, bleeding emotive layers of melodies and harmonies and a great way to close the affair.
Growing Pains by Ritalin is an energising and upbeat melodic feast of youthful energy. From the multitude of layered harmonies, the blistering yet emotive guitar melodies, to the outstanding tone and delivery of Leah Duane's vocals, I can confidently say that Ritalin are a band to be taken seriously and I think this is an EP they can be proud of.
